The Vanishing Body Technique
The Vanishing Body Technique ✨
One of the techniques I share in my book is the Vanishing Body Technique.
This is a simple but powerful practice where you use your imagination to slowly dissolve the feeling of the physical body. Instead of feeling limited by the body, you begin to experience awareness as something much larger - something that can expand beyond your physical form.
The purpose of this technique is to train your awareness to become less focused on the physical senses and more open to exploring consciousness itself. This makes it a beautiful practice for astral projection, where we are doing something very similar - shifting our awareness beyond the body.
You can imagine your body becoming lighter, fading into the space around you, or even disappearing completely while your awareness remains present.
